The Directorate of Knowledge Management in Agriculture is committed to promote ICT driven technology and information dissemination system for quick, effectual and cost-effective delivery of messages to all the stakeholders in agriculture. Keeping pace with the current knowledge diffusion trends, Directorate is delivering and showcasing ICAR technologies, policies and other activities through print, electronic and web mode. Directorate is the nodal center for design, maintenance and updating of ICAR website along with facilitation of network connectivity across ICAR institutes and KVKs. Besides, Directorate provides public relation and publicity support to the council and its constituents across the country.

Thrust Areas

  • Dissemination and sharing of agricultural knowledge and information through value added information products in print, electronic and web mode.
  • Development of e-resources on agricultural knowledge and information for global exposure.
  • Facilitation for strengthening e-connectivity among ICAR institutes State Agricultural Universities  and KVKs.
  • Capacity building for agricultural knowledge management and communication.

Achievements

  • Publication of authoritative and benchmark publications under Handbook series- Handbook of Agriculture, Handbook of Horticulture, Handbook of Animal Husbandry and Handbook of Fisheries.
  • Launched a series of agricultural popular books, Agri-Pop series for imparting knowledge at grass root level.
  • Reoriented ICAR popular magazines to make demand -driven and competitive.
  • Facilitating online access to 2000 journals from a single subscription in more than 123 libraries under cerra project of NAIP.
  • The ICAR website was revamped to make it more user- friendly with links to related organizations and issuing weather based agro -advisories.
  • National Agricultural Research Database was developed and bibliographic inputs were provided for inclusion in agris database (FAO).
  • A Hub has been operationalized at ICAR Hq. for e-connectivity of 192 Krishi Vigyan Kendras (KVK) and 8 Zonal Project Directorates (ZPD) in the country.
  • A centralized and secure state-of-the-art datacenter is being established for providing e-mail and website hosting services for whole ICAR system
  • A National Knowledge Network project of Government of India has provided link to 9 ICAR institutes/SAUs and rest of the institutes will be linked gradually to 100 mbps broadband.
  • Established Video Conferencing and IP Telephony facility at 23 selected ICAR Institutes connected on ICAR-ERNET network.
  • Under outreach programme, video films depicting successful technologies were produced and  telecast over National and Lok Sabha channel. Dedicated radio (AIR) and television (Doordarshan) programmes on ICAR launched
  • Facilitating organization of Media Meets at ICAR institutes.
  • The monthly research journals, Indian Journal of Agricultural Sciences and Indian Journal of Animal Sciences made available in open-access mode besides availability of in-house journals on ICAR website.
  • Launched/co-operated NAIP sponsored projects for E-publishing of research of publications, standardization of websites of ICAR institutes, development of a digital Information dissemination system for ICAR and mobilization of mass media support for sharing agricultural knowledge  .
  • Capacity building of ICAR scientists for agricultural communication and knowledge management through training courses at Indian Institute of Mass Communication, New Delhi and Indian Institute of Management, Lucknow.
